What is mjcriu.dll?

mjcriu.dll is developed by Bjoern Petersen Software Design'n'Development according to the mjcriu.dll version information.

mjcriu.dll's description is "VST plugin for BASS 2.4"

mjcriu.dll is usually located in the 'c:\Users\Giovanni Junior\AppData\Roaming\Microsoft\' folder.

Some of the anti-virus scanners at VirusTotal detected mjcriu.dll.
